WebApr 13, 2024 · The first of these claims was Aercap Ireland Limited (“Aercap”) v AIG and Others. Aercap issued a claim for US$3.5bn in respect of more than 140 aircraft and 29 aircraft engines owned by the American-Irish company. The claim was initially commenced against AIG Europe S.A. and Lloyd’s Insurance Company S.A. as representative …

WebApr 13, 2024 · Aercap protests fail as Russian aircraft claims to be heard together. Five lawsuits in which aircraft leasing companies are collectively seeking more than $4bn for the loss of planes stranded in Russia are to be heard concurrently in one trial, a Commercial Court judge has decided. 14 Mar 2024
